If you replace the question mark in the grid below with a certain letter of the alphabet, you will then be able to form five different eight-letter words, each using the missing letter. The words must be spelled out by moving from letter to adjacent letter either horizontally, vertically, or diagonally (as in the Parker Brothers game Boggle). No square may be used twice in the same word.

There is also a sixth eight-letter word that can be formed without using the missing letter. What letter should replace the question mark, and what are the six words?

R I L I
E LE F
D I ? R
NOVE

Answers:

The missing letter is K, and the five words using K are:

LIFELIKE
OVERKILL
KINDLIER
LIKELIER
REKINDLE

The sixth word is OVERFILL.
